Athletics Claim Taylor Rashi: What Does This Mean for Oakland's Bullpen? (2026)

In the ever-evolving world of Major League Baseball, the Oakland Athletics have made a move that could prove pivotal in their quest for pitching depth. The A's have claimed right-hander Taylor Rashi off waivers from the Minnesota Twins, a transaction that sets the stage for an intriguing narrative.

The Journey of Taylor Rashi

Rashi's journey began with the Arizona Diamondbacks, who traded him to the Twins in early June. However, his time with the Twins was short-lived, as he never made an appearance for the team. Instead, he spent his time in the Twins organization at Triple-A St. Paul, where his performance was a mixed bag. With a 4.76 ERA and a high walk rate, Rashi's time with the Twins came to an end, and he was released from their 40-man roster to make way for a promising shortstop prospect.

A New Chapter in Oakland

Now, Rashi finds himself with the Oakland Athletics, a team in dire need of pitching reinforcements. With the worst bullpen ERA in the league, the A's are hoping Rashi can provide a much-needed boost. However, the question remains: will he make an immediate impact, or will his minor league options be explored first?

The Intriguing Dynamics

What makes this move particularly fascinating is the contrast between Rashi's minor league and major league performances. In the minors, he has showcased impressive control and an ERA of 3.22 in over 114 innings. However, his major league numbers tell a different story, with a higher ERA and a walk rate that could be a cause for concern.
